How to Use Discord Voice Channel Watermark for Recording Identification
🔍 WiseChecker

How to Use Discord Voice Channel Watermark for Recording Identification

Discord voice channels do not have a built-in watermark feature that overlays text on recorded video. However, server administrators and moderators often need to identify who recorded a voice conversation, especially when dealing with leaks or policy violations. The term “watermark” in this context refers to methods that embed identifiable information, such as user ID or nickname, into the audio or metadata of a recording. This article explains how to use Discord bots and manual settings to create a voice channel watermark for recording identification.

Key Takeaways: How to Identify Voice Channel Recordings on Discord

  • Discord built-in recording feature (Soundboard > Voice Settings > Record): Records voice channel audio locally but does not add a visible watermark.
  • Third-party bots like Craig or Dyno (Server Settings > Integrations > Bot Invite): Add a text watermark with user ID and timestamp to recorded audio files.
  • Manual naming convention (File Explorer > Rename): Append user nickname and date to the recording file name for identification.

ADVERTISEMENT

Understanding Voice Channel Watermark for Recording Identification

Discord does not natively add a watermark to voice recordings. A watermark is typically a visible or audible marker that identifies the source. For voice recordings, a watermark can be a spoken intro, a text overlay in the file metadata, or a label in the file name. The goal is to link a recording to a specific user, channel, and time. This is useful for server moderation, compliance, or evidence gathering. Before you can identify recordings, you need a way to record voice channels. Discord lets you record voice channels if you have a server boost or use third-party bots. The most reliable method for adding a watermark is using a bot that automatically inserts user information into the recording file.

What a Voice Channel Watermark Includes

A proper watermark for recording identification contains three pieces of data: the user who started the recording, the voice channel name, and the timestamp. Some bots add the user ID and server name. This information helps you trace who recorded a conversation and when. Without a watermark, you only have the audio file with no context about who made the recording.

Steps to Set Up a Voice Channel Watermark Using a Bot

The most effective way to add a watermark to Discord voice recordings is by using a dedicated bot. The Craig bot is a popular choice because it records multiple users separately and adds metadata. Follow these steps to set up Craig for watermark identification.

  1. Invite the Craig bot to your server
    Go to the Craig bot website at craig.chat. Click the “Invite” button. Select your Discord server from the dropdown. Authorize the bot with the necessary permissions: Read Messages, Connect to Voice, and Use Voice Activity.
  2. Grant the bot voice channel access
    Open Discord and go to Server Settings > Roles. Find the Craig role. Enable Connect and Speak permissions for the voice channels you want to record. If you use channel-specific permissions, go to the voice channel settings and add the Craig role with Connect and Speak allowed.
  3. Start a recording with a watermark command
    Join the voice channel you want to record. Type !craig:join in any text channel. The bot will join the voice channel and start recording. To add a watermark, use the command !craig:join --watermark. This adds a text watermark to each audio file containing the user name, user ID, and timestamp.
  4. Stop the recording and download files
    When you are done, type !craig:leave in the same text channel. The bot will leave and upload the recording files to the text channel. Each file is named with the user nickname and a timestamp. The watermark appears as a short audio clip at the beginning of each file stating the user name and time.
  5. Verify the watermark in the audio file
    Open the downloaded audio file in a media player. Listen to the first few seconds. The Craig bot inserts a synthetic voice that says “Recording by [user name] at [time].” This is the audible watermark. The file name also contains the user ID for cross-reference.

ADVERTISEMENT

If You Need a Visual Watermark on Screen Recordings

If you are screen recording a voice channel and want a visual watermark, Discord does not offer this feature. You must use external software like OBS Studio. In OBS, you can add a text source overlay that displays the user name and channel. This overlay is visible on the recorded video. To set this up, create a text source in OBS and type the user name. Then start recording your screen along with the voice channel audio from Discord. This method requires manual input for each recording session.

Common Issues and Limitations of Voice Channel Watermarks

Bot Cannot Join the Voice Channel

If the Craig bot does not join the voice channel, check the bot role permissions. Ensure the bot has Connect and Speak permissions for that specific voice channel. Also confirm that the bot is online and has not been rate-limited. Restarting the bot with !craig:restart can resolve temporary issues.

Watermark Is Missing from the Audio File

If you used !craig:join without the --watermark flag, the bot records without a watermark. Re-run the command with the flag. If the watermark is still missing, check that the bot has the latest version. Use !craig:version to confirm. Update the bot by re-inviting it from the website.

Audio Quality Is Low or Distorted

Craig records in the same quality as Discord audio. If users have poor microphone settings or network issues, the recording quality drops. Ask users to check their Voice Settings > Voice Processing in Discord. Disable Advanced Voice Activity and Echo Cancellation if distortion occurs.

Comparison of Discord Voice Recording Watermark Methods

Item Craig Bot Watermark OBS Visual Overlay
Type of watermark Audible synthetic voice and file metadata Visual text overlay on video
Automation level Fully automatic with bot command Manual setup required each session
User identification data User name, user ID, timestamp User name only if manually typed
Requires external software No, only bot invite Yes, OBS or similar screen recorder
Works for audio-only recordings Yes No, only video recordings

Discord voice channel watermarks are not a native feature, but you can achieve recording identification using the Craig bot with the watermark flag. This method adds an audible watermark and file metadata that includes the user name and timestamp. For screen recordings, use OBS with a text overlay as a visual watermark. Always test the watermark command in a private channel before recording sensitive conversations. Remember that recording voice channels without consent may violate Discord Terms of Service, so inform all participants before starting a recording.

ADVERTISEMENT